What happens after tattooing
The first thing worth noting is that all such procedures are done in almost the same way as any tattoos. The master with the help of a needle with paint makes micro-punctures on the skin, leaving pigment under its upper layer. Eyebrows are usually made either in the hair technique, when individual hairs are drawn, or in the technique of shading, then the pigment stains the skin under the hairs. One way or another, in response to many small punctures, the skin reacts with inflammation. This manifests itself in the form of redness and swelling, as well as in the form of secretions of the anemone.

Depending on the amount of secreted eyebrows, one can judge the number and thickness of the crusts that form on the eyebrows. These crusts will gradually pass, as the skin will gradually heal. Absolutely forbidden
The first and most important prohibition applies to these very crusts - in no case can they be ripped off, removed or even touched. Removing it, you will open a wound, which can easily and quickly get an infection. In addition, part of the pigment may come down with the crust, and this will give bald spots in the finished eyebrows. Removing such a crust, you can open a wet wound, which after healing forms a fossa, that is, a scar. Subsequently, hair will not grow on this site and the pigment in case of repeated tattooing may lie poorly. Therefore, remember how to care for the eyebrows after tattooing - do not even think about rubbing them with your hands or a towel or rinsing off the crusts with any cosmetic means.

Also, do not apply decorative cosmetics on eyebrows. In order not to dry the already injured skin, do not include alcohol-based products in eyebrow care after tattooing. In the early days, do not use mechanical manipulations, such as plucking and shaving hairs, on the tattooed area of the skin.
It is forbidden during the healing period and the aggressive effects of light and heat, which means no bath or sauna, no steaming of the face and, of course, no tanning in the solarium or on the beach.
How to care for eyebrows after tattoo in the early days
So, you did the eyebrow tattoo. The skin will completely heal in 7-10 days, however, in the first 2-3 days after the injured area, especially careful care is required, aimed at removing the edema and healing. The greatest swelling will be visible the next morning after the procedure, and already on the third day it will practically subside. To make this happen faster, you can drink an antihistamine, such as a pill “Suprastin” or “Zodak”. An ice cube will also help remove the swelling, but do not apply it to the eyebrows immediately, but wrap it in a clean soft towel.
So that the crusts are not too thick and do not crack, the prominent sac can be slightly dampened with a clean dry cloth, but only slightly and not too often - do this twice a day in the first three days after tattooing. Also, twice a day you need to process the eyebrows with Chlorhexidine. Slightly moisten a cotton pad in the liquid and treat the skin with a soaking motion. This will help protect her from infection.

What to smear
This question is one of the most important in how to care for eyebrows after eyebrow tattooing. Reviews of the procedure note that correctly selected funds are very helpful in healing. However, we clarify that the tattooed areas of the skin should be smeared not so that it regenerates faster, but so that the crusts do not dry out and crack. Therefore, the best than you can smear your eyebrows - cosmetic petroleum jelly. Even baby cream will not be as good as regular petroleum jelly. Moreover, you need to smear it with a very thin layer, because otherwise you will achieve the opposite effect - the crusts will get wet, which can lead to inflammation.

Often, when studying the question of how to care for eyebrows after eyebrow tattooing, one can come across recommendations to apply wound healing ointments, for example, Solcoseryl, Bepanten, or Rescuer, but many experts advise not to use them. Such drugs cause the body to develop local immunity, which can tear away the pigment introduced under the skin, and you will get an unpredictable result.
How to care for eyebrows after tattooing the first week
After the first three days, when care is needed very thorough, the picture becomes more attractive. The swelling has already gone, the pain has been forgotten, and the most important thing here is not to give up positions and continue to care for your eyebrows. Until the crusts have come off, and this is still a maximum of 5-7 days, they need special care.
Continue treating the skin with Chlorhexidine, but include hydration in your skin care, as this drug dries out the skin. Smear the area around the eyebrows (but not the eyebrows themselves) with a moisturizing eye cream or olive oil. Wash your face with not too hot water without the use of scrubs and aggressive products; wipe your face with only soaking movements.
What's next
So, your eyebrows have completely changed - the swelling has subsided, the crusts have disappeared, the color of the pigment has become even and more natural - it's time to forget about all the difficulties that have been overcome and enjoy your reflection in the mirror. However, it is important to remember that within three weeks after tattooing, do not sunbathe in a solarium or in the bright sun, as the pigment is still very fresh and will quickly burn out from exposure to ultraviolet radiation. Keep this in mind when planning to make eyebrows before your vacation. And in the city, wear sunglasses and use makeup with SPF.
When the healing has passed
Do not think that now that you have a tattoo, you do not need eyebrow care. If the excess hairs outside the drawn contour have grown from the moment of the procedure, gently pluck them, and cut out the long sticking ones with sharp scissors.
The color and shape of eyebrows are usually pleasing up to six months after the procedure, and then the brightness can be added using a pencil, permanent paint or additional correction with permanent pigment.
